Sad to hear about Bills passing.  First met him back in 1968 I think, he was PD of WBSR in Pensacola and I was a young Navy guy just stationed at Correy Field.  Saw the station and stopped by to say hi.  Was talking to some of the jocks in the lobby and mentioned that I had worked at WCOL in Ohio and he popped his head out of the office.  Offered me a part time gig on the spot!  Lot of fun at that station and never a cross word from the PD, just encouragement and subtle "adjustments" for any transgressions  Roll Eyes

If theres a Rock and Roll radio station in Heaven Bill is signing on.  Condolences to his family.

I had the distinct pleasure of working with/for Bill Burkett from 2003 thru 2009 and remained close friends with him after moving from the Sevierville market to the Knoxville market.  Bill and I did the Mountain Morning Show with Bill and Tammy on 106.3 The Mountain, and prior to that did the afternoon drive on Mix 105.5.  He was my mentor on so many levels, but I think most importantly he showed me how to be myself and maintain my humility.  I love Bill and will miss him in my life, on the air, in my town...forever.  The world will never be the same for Bill's absence from it.
